What I Check First: Compatibility

The first thing I always check is whether the band case fits my Apple Watch model. I make sure it matches the correct size, such as 38mm, 40mm, 41mm, 42mm, 44mm, 45mm, or 49mm, depending on my watch. If I skip this step, I risk buying something that does not fit properly.

Material Quality Matters to Me

I pay close attention to the material because it affects both comfort and durability. I usually compare:

  • Silicone for softness and flexibility
  • Leather for a more classic look
  • Stainless steel for a premium feel
  • Nylon for lightweight everyday wear

For me, the best material depends on how I plan to use the band case. If I want something for workouts, I prefer silicone or nylon. If I want something for work or formal settings, I lean toward leather or metal.

Comfort Is a Big Priority

I never ignore comfort because I wear my Apple Watch for long periods. I look for smooth edges, adjustable sizing, and a design that does not pinch my skin. If the band case feels too stiff or heavy, I know I probably will not enjoy wearing it every day.

Protection Features I Look For

Since I want my Apple Watch to last, I look for a band case that offers real protection. I prefer options that help guard against:

  • Scratches
  • Minor bumps
  • Dust
  • Everyday wear and tear

If I am especially active, I like a case with raised edges or a protective cover around the watch face.

Style and Appearance

I also care about how the band case looks. I want it to fit my personal style and match my outfits. Some days I want a sporty look, while other days I prefer something sleek and minimal. I usually choose a design that feels versatile so I can wear it in different settings.

Ease of Installation

I prefer a band case that is easy to put on and remove. If it takes too much effort or feels like it might damage the watch, I avoid it. A good Apple Watch band case should snap on securely without making me struggle.

Water and Sweat Resistance

Because I use my watch throughout the day, I look for a band case that can handle sweat and occasional moisture. This is especially important when I exercise or wear the watch in warm weather. I like materials that are easy to clean and do not absorb odors quickly.

Price and Value

I always compare price with value. A cheaper band case may seem attractive, but I ask myself whether it will last. Sometimes I prefer spending a little more for better comfort, stronger materials, and a cleaner finish. For me, value matters more than just the lowest price.
